Colton Christian Church Celebrates 75 Years

Gathering to celebrate the 75th Anniversary of the Colton Christian Church at 905 E. Olive St. in Colton, were 122 members, guests and friends. The event's special guest was Janice Baldal, 87, of Redding, an original charter member of the church. The church began with a children’s Bible class in a home on Fairview St. in 1938, then developed into an Adult Bible Study, then to a tent-church at the present location. The present building was dedicated in 1958. Now there are three services, Traditional English morning service at 10:45 a.m.; Spanish Service at 2 p.m. and Contemporary English Service “Living Water” at 6 p.m. Some services include: weekday bible studies in English and Spanish,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) meetings, food distributions and once a month a hot meal; “Feed the Hungry.”
